Additional Responsibilities Include
  • Performs general cleaning and upkeep of public areas, including stairwells, walkways, sales areas, lobby, and other common spaces, ensuring all areas are clean, safe, organized, and meets HGV brand standards at all times.
  • Maintains the cleanliness and presentation of high visibility areas such as the lobby, entrances, glass doors, and walkways, ensuring a consistently polished appearance.
  • Cleans and restocks public restrooms, fitness areas, and other shared spaces, ensuring supplies are replenished and spaces are guest ready throughout the day.
  • Maintains pool decks and surrounding areas, ensuring cleanliness, organization, and prompt reporting of any safety concerns or maintenance issues.
  • Identifies and reports maintenance needs or deficiencies in a timely manner to support overall property standards.
  • Greets guests with heartfelt hospitality and provides basic assistance or information regarding resort amenities and local attractions as needed.
  • Ensures trash areas are clean, organized, and properly maintained. Assists with replenishing amenities and supplies in public spaces.
  • Maintains carts, equipment, supplies and storage areas in a neat, safe, organized, and well stocked condition.
  • Observes and reports any safety hazards or unusual activity to ensure a safe environment for guests and team members.
  • Embodies Inspired Hospitality and the Hilton Grand Vacations Values of Hospitality, Integrity, Leadership, Teamwork, Ownership, Now,
  • Follows all safety procedures, key control protocols, and lost and found procedures.
  • Completes all required Company training/compliance courses as assigned.
  • Adheres to Company standards and maintains compliance with all policies and procedures.
  • Performs other related duties as assigned.
